Cheap Flights from Johannesburg O.R. Tambo to Bangkok

Travellers and cabin class

Compare Johannesburg O.R. Tambo to Bangkok flight deals

Find the cheapest month or even day of the year to fly to Bangkok

Book the best Bangkok fare with no extra fees

Flight deals from Johannesburg O.R. Tambo to Bangkok

Looking for a cheap last-minute deal or the best return flight from Johannesburg O.R. Tambo to Bangkok? Find the lowest prices on one-way and return tickets right here.

Find the cheapest month to fly from Johannesburg O.R. Tambo to Bangkok

We’re always keeping an eye on fares, so you can find the best one in seconds. It looks like Johannesburg O.R. Tambo to Bangkok flights are currently cheapest in April.

Alternative Johannesburg O.R. Tambo to Bangkok routes

Looking for the cheapest, fastest or easiest route from Johannesburg O.R. Tambo to Bangkok? You could fly into the following airports instead.

Johannesburg to Bangkok: Flight information

The things to know before you go.
Cheapest flight foundR 5,179
Cheapest month to flyApril

Finding cheap flights from Johannesburg O.R. Tambo to Bangkok: Frequently asked questions

There are 2 airports in Bangkok: Don Mueang and Bangkok Suvarnabhumi.
The best price we found for a return flight from Johannesburg O.R. Tambo to Bangkok is R 9,239. This is an estimate based on information collected from different airlines and travel providers over the last 4 days and is subject to change and availability.
Currently, there are no airlines that fly direct from Johannesburg O.R. Tambo to Bangkok. But we found flights with one or more stops from R 9,239.
As of March 2025, there are no flights flying from Johannesburg O.R. Tambo to Bangkok.
The cheapest month to fly from Johannesburg O.R. Tambo to Bangkok is usually March 2025.
If you're flying from Johannesburg O.R. Tambo Airport, the cheapest airport near Bangkok is Bangkok Suvarnabhumi – which is 28.5 km away from the centre of Bangkok. We've found flights into this airport from R 9,239.
After crunching the numbers on our flight calendar, we found that it's currently cheapest to fly from Johannesburg O.R. Tambo Airport to Bangkok on Saturday, 24 January 2026.
No airlines currently offer direct flights between Johannesburg O.R. Tambo Airport and Bangkok. Most routes have one or more stops.
We show every price from over 1,200 airlines and travel agents, comparing them all so you don’t have to. If you know you want to fly to Bangkok but you’re not ready to book, set up a Price Alert. We’ll track prices for you, and let you know when they rise or fall.
We crunched all the numbers in our flight calendar and it looks like the cheapest time to book a flight to Bangkok is around 40 days in advance, so don’t leave your flight to the last minute.
In March, the average temperature is usually around 30°C. April is typically the warmest month in Bangkok, when it usually averages around 35°C. You can expect the least rain in December. The coldest month is November, with temperatures averaging 22°C. The rainiest month is September.
Currently, Singapore Airlines offers the cheapest flight tickets to Bangkok.

Flying from O.R. Tambo International Airport (JNB) to Bangkok: what you need to know

  • O.R. Tambo International Airport is located in Johannesburg. Based in the UTC+7 timezone, Bangkok is 5 hours ahead of Johannesburg.

  • For a stress-free journey, turn up at the airport two hours ahead of international flights and one hour before domestic departures. This will give you enough time to board your flight from JNB to Bangkok.

  • Flying during a peak month like July? Public holidays and other high seasons can mean longer lines at security. Play it safe and arrive up to four hours ahead of an international flight and two hours before a domestic departure.

  • Stopovers are the ideal opportunity to break up your trip — and perhaps even tour another city. When searching for flights from JNB to Bangkok, uncheck the 'Direct flights only' box to see where you can visit along the way. Top options include:

    • Hong Kong International Airport (HKG)

    • Changi International Airport (SIN)

    • Dubai Airport (DXB)

  • If you have a passport from South Africa, you will need an embassy visa to enter Thailand. This applies if you're booking a cheap ticket from O.R. Tambo International Airport to Bangkok for tourism purposes. The rules may be different if you're travelling for work or other reasons. Always check the visa rules ahead of booking and definitely before you fly.

  • The journey from central Johannesburg to JNB takes around 1 hour and 12 minutes on public transport. If you ride-share, drive or get a cab, you'll cover the 29 kilometres in 29 minutes or so, depending on traffic.

  • After a hassle-free start to your break? Stay near JNB. Whether you've booked an early flight from O.R. Tambo International Airport to Bangkok or just don't want to be rushed, these hotels have you covered:

How to find the cheapest flights from O.R. Tambo International Airport (JNB) to Bangkok

  • R 5,179 is the lowest price for a one-way ticket from O.R. Tambo International Airport to Bangkok. Return flights start at R 9,239. These prices can change based on availability and demand.

  • Don't leave everything to the last moment. You're more likely to get cheap tickets from JNB to Bangkok if you book early. Airlines often offer some amazing early bird rates.

  • Getting cheap tickets from O.R. Tambo International Airport to Bangkok is easier if you're flexible with your travel plans. Check out the 'Whole month' search tool to see the best prices across every month and snap up a great deal.

  • Finding a cheap ticket from JNB to Bangkok is a breeze with Price Alerts. All you need to do is create one of these automatic alerts and we'll get in touch when there's a better deal.

  • Tailor your travel plans with filters. Pick your ideal departure and arrival times, total journey duration and airlines. You can also sort results by 'Fastest,' 'Cheapest' or 'Best' flights from O.R. Tambo International Airport to Bangkok.

Airports in Bangkok

Suvarnabhumi Airport (BKK)

  • Suvarnabhumi Airport (BKK) to central Bangkok is approximately 32 kilometres. It takes about 35 minutes to reach the centre driving.

  • Travelling to the centre by public transport will take you roughly 1 hour and 6 minutes.

  • If you're arriving on a late flight from O.R. Tambo International Airport to Bangkok, nothing beats the convenience of staying near the terminal. Grab your luggage from the carousel and then be showered and snoozing soon after at one of these hotels near BKK:

Don Mueang International Airport (DMK)

  • The centre of Bangkok is located around 27 kilometres from Don Mueang International Airport (DMK). Once your flight from O.R. Tambo International Airport to Bangkok has touched down and you've navigated your way to arrivals, expect a drive of about 30 minutes.

  • You can also opt for public transport, which will take roughly 1 hour and 5 minutes.

  • After your flight from JNB to Bangkok, tuck yourself in at a hotel close to DMK. These are some comfortable accommodation options that'll help you get into relaxation mode:

Best time to go to Bangkok

  • July is the most popular month for flights from O.R. Tambo International Airport to Bangkok. To escape the crowds, travel to Bangkok in April when it's quieter.

  • Before you book a flight from O.R. Tambo International Airport to Bangkok, think about the type of weather you enjoy. April is the warmest month in Bangkok, with the temperature ranging from 26ºC to 37ºC.

  • If you want to travel in cooler conditions, lock in a cheap flight from JNB to Bangkok in December when temperatures average between 19ºC and 33ºC.

More about Bangkok

  • After booking your flight from O.R. Tambo International Airport to Bangkok, think about where you want to stay in this city. Make one of these accommodation options your base for exploring Bangkok:

  • Grand Palace and Wat Arun are just a couple of the major attractions to add to your Bangkok to-do list. Keep the adventure rolling by checking out Wat Phra Kaew.

Complete your Bangkok trip with a car rental

  • Select one of our car rentals in Bangkok and explore the city on your own schedule. Easily compare companies in one place to find the ideal ride once you've locked in your hotel and cheap flights from O.R. Tambo International Airport to Bangkok.

Prices shown on this page are estimated lowest prices only. Found in the last 45 days.